Neptune’s 165-Year Cycle and the Shift into Aries
Neptune is the planet of dreams, hope, inspiration and spirituality - essentially all that is unseen. It completes its 165-year cycle in January 2026, on the 26th to be exact (26/1/26).

We were given a brief preview of what is to come when Neptune dipped into Aries for a short time in 2025. Now we get to explore and experience this new energy, as Neptune begins a long transit through Aries that will continue until 2038-9.

Whenever the outer planets change signs, it marks a significant collective shift. Neptune is a generational planet in astrology, meaning its movement shapes the collective consciousness rather than individual experience alone.

What Neptune Represents in Astrology
Neptune represents vision, ideals, imagination and reflection. It is creative, intangible, mystical and surreal. Watery and ethereal by nature, Neptune can blur the boundaries between reality and illusion, making it difficult at times to discern what is true, solid or sustainable.

Neptune in Aries and the Rise of New Leadership
What I feel very strongly with Neptune in Aries is the rise of a new type of leadership. This will be further supported and anchored by Saturn’s ingress into Aries just weeks after Neptune’s entry. Most notably, Neptune and Saturn meet at 0° Aries in February (20th) - which is a monumental moment within the astrological year.

Aries is the sign of leadership, initiation and courage.  The pioneer, (sometimes seen as the Fool) who moves forward without hesitation. In its lower expression, Aries can be impulsive, naïve or even aggressive, with its ruling planet Mars associated with war and conflict. However, Neptune’s influence is likely to soften and spiritualise this archetype, dissolving old patterns of competition and comparison as it does so.

I see the emergence of leaders who are more compassionate, inspiring and creative - leaders who know who they are and have the courage to step into the unknown, trusting that others will naturally follow. This is not a top-down approach, but a model rooted in authenticity and inner authority.

A Slow but Powerful Beginning
This is, of course, a slow and gradual transit. These changes will not happen overnight. With Aries representing the Zero Point, there may be moments of uncertainty - much like a child learning a new skill. Practice, patience and courage are required.

What matters most are the seeds being planted now, which will take root and eventually blossom into something truly new.

Aries is cardinal fire - fast-moving, initiating and action-oriented. Combined with the universal 10/1 year of 2026 and the energy of the Fire Horse, we are likely to feel an acceleration of pace. Working with Neptune in Aries Personally
To work with this ingress on a personal level, look at where 0° Aries falls in your natal chart. The house it activates reveals where this bold new beginning is unfolding for you - and where you are being invited to lead with courage, vision and soul.
